Specifically, Authum Investment & Infrastructure Ltd dropped by 4.39% to a price of Rs 2617.65. This represents a major downturn for the company, highlighting potential concerns amongst investors. Trading activity was notably high, with 7981 shares changing hands – significantly more than the 230 shares typically traded in a month.
Honeywell Automation India Ltd followed closely, falling by 4.39% to Rs 34944.4. The company’s value decreased considerably, signaling a negative outlook for the business. Trading volume was at 265 shares, which is also higher than normal.
V I P Industries Ltd also experienced a decline of 4.36% to Rs 354.25. The increased trading volume of 9467 shares indicates heightened investor interest and potentially, anxieties surrounding the company’s performance. This demonstrates the sensitivity of the market to industry trends.
Finally, Acutaas Chemicals Ltd saw a slip of 4.28% to Rs 1794.1. The notable trading volume of 27683 shares indicates significant investor scrutiny and a possible reaction to company-specific news or market conditions.
